IPL 2024 – Match 21: Top 3 Records That Could Be Broken in Today’s LSG vs GT Match

Lucknow Super Giants' skipper KL Rahul is just three sixes away from reaching the milestone of 300 sixes in T20s.

The 21st Match of the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2024 will be played against Lucknow SuperGiants and Gujarat Titans at Ekana Sports City in Lucknow. The match is scheduled on 7th April at 7:30 pm. 

KL Rahul-led Lucknow Super Giants are currently placed 4th in the table winning two out of three games While GT is placed on 7th in the table winning 2 games in 4 games. Gujarat Titans will be led by Shubman Gill. 

Both the teams share the tag of New Entrants in IPL but have been consistent in reaching the playoffs. GT won IPL 2022 while Reaching the Finals in 2023. LSG too have Been a consistent name in the playoffs. 

Here are some records that could be broken in the match –

  1. David Miller was out with an injury in the last game. Miller (195) needs five fours to reach 200 fours in IPL. 
  1. Krunal Pandya (45) needs five catches to reach 50 catches in the IPL. 
  1.  LSG captain is all set to break a record. KL Rahul (297) needs another three sixes to reach 300 sixes in T20s.
